Flood Water Extraction Process: What to Expect

Our process for flood water extraction is designed to restore your property to its pre-damaged state. We begin by assessing the extent of the damage and determining the best course of action. Our team will explain every step of the process to you and answer any questions you may have.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Moisture readings are taken to find out the extent of the water damage. Our team will set up containment barriers to prevent further damage and drying equipment to begin the drying process.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Industrial-grade pumps are used to extract standing water from your property. This is the fastest way to remove water and pr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Air movers and dehumidifiers are used to dry your property and remove excess moisture.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and further dam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Biohazardous cleaning products are used to clean and sanitize your property, removing any remaining bacteria and contaminants.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Our team will work with you to restore your property to its pre-damaged state. This may include replacing damaged materials, repairing walls, and refinishing floors.

Flood Water Extraction Cost in Catalina Foothills, AZ

The cost of flood water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Catalina Foothills, AZ.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Flood Water Extraction $500-$2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Dehumidification and Drying $200-$1,000 Size of affected area, humidity levels
Moisture Detection $100-$500 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Containment and Barriers $500-$2,000 Size of affected area, type of barriers used
Sanitizing and Cleaning $200-$1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used
